BODY
I. (Main Point 1) Setting off fireworks and firecrackers causes great pollution,
including air pollution, noise pollution and Solid waste pollution..
A. (Subpoint 1) The explosion of fireworks and firecrackers produces many kinds of
poisonous gases, such as SO2, NO2, NO.
1 According to the report of the environmental monitoring station in many cities,
during the spring festival the SO2, NO2, NO in the air increased to a level that
higher than the standard set by the law.
2 These gases do great harm to our Respiratory System, nervous system,
cardiovascular system as well as our eyes.
B. (Subpoint 2) Besides, noise is another pollution caused by fireworks and firecrackers.
1 The national standard of noise is 45 db, which is the highest level that human being
can stand. But according the data from the Environmental monitoring departments,
setting off fireworks and firecrackers may make noise of 125 db.
2 Such noise not only affects our daily life but also does harm to our auditory system.
More importantly, it may stimulate many diseases such as heart disease and cranial
vascular diseases, which is particularly harmful for the old.
C. (Subpoint 3) Except for air pollution and noise pollution, Solid waste pollution is
another problem that can not be ignored.
1 Just imagining whats left after the display of fireworks and firecrackers: scrapes of
1

paper and dust everywhere on the ground.


2 Such great amount of garbage is a great burden for the environment.

II.

(Main Point 2) The explosion of fireworks and firecrackers lets out much power which
may cause fire.
A. (Subpoint 1) According to the city firework hall of Beijing, there were 194 fires caused
by fireworks, bringing about 2 deaths and 388 injuries. Severe fire disasters also
occurred in other cities, such as Shenyang and Shanghai.
B. (Subpoint 2)As for the injuries, its more common. On the first day of the new-year
Shenzhen Eye Hospital received more than 20 patients who injured their eyes when
setting off fireworks. In Shenzhen Hospital there were also more than 10 patients that
were the same case. Such cases also occurred in other hospitals all around the country,
and most of them were children.
